Le P'tit Chez Moi
Self service vegetarian buffet priced by weight. Soups, savory tarts and desserts priced by unit. Fully organic, mainly vegan (clearly labeled) and a majority of gluten-free made-in-house food. Open Tue-Fri 12:00pm-2:00pm, Sat 12:00pm-6:00pm.

Vegan/vegetarian on cosy street - Edit
France is a tough place for vegans and Le P'tit Chez Moi provides an oasis for vegetarians/vegans outside of the "downtown" area of Bordeaux. We arrived around 3pm, late by French lunch standards, and there was very little food left on the buffet. The owner was really nice (speaking perfect English) to help us pull together a meal from what was left. The food was fresh and mostly vegan, with a variety of salads, a yummy vegan onion tart, and good hummus and bread. There are hot food options too. There are vegan and vegetarian dessert options as well as soy milk for coffees.
Pros: English spoken , Mostly vegan food , Wifi
Cons: No outdoor seating , Food runs out by 3pm
